**Q: How does the Scanbright barcode integration authenticate?**

Good question for review: the handheld units talk to our Ledgerloop inventory service over mutual TLS — no shared API tokens floating around. Device certs rotate monthly. If a unit gets bricked mid-rotation, there's an offline recovery mode. To activate it, enter the recovery passphrase below.

recovery phrase for tagug-yagug: lamox-gilax-keleth-gilath

## Ownership

Heads up, reviewer: this branch is the cron drift investigation for the Lanternside batch runners. The fix itself is small; most of the diff is instrumentation we'll rip out later. Don't block on style in the probe scripts. Anything touching the scheduler config, though, needs a second pair of eyes. Questions, concerns, or merge approval all go through the investigation owner named below.

named custodian: Brivan Eliath Quenox Frador

TURN-208: Gatevale turnstile counters at the Merrow Field pilot double-count when a rotation reverses mid-cycle. Attendance totals drift roughly 2% high per event. The debounce window fix is implemented, reviewed by Ilsa, and soak-tested across two simulated match days without drift. Ready for your cut; the candidate build is identified below.

trace token, tagag-tafog: htk6_5ed18c

Quarterly Planning Note — Churn in the Harbourline Pilot

Churn in the Harbourline pilot sits at 9.4% for the quarter, up from 7.1%. Exit surveys point to onboarding friction and pricing confusion rather than product gaps. The Nortveil cohort performed better after we added the guided setup flow, so we will extend that to all pilot accounts in week two. Staffing stays flat; Marisa Quenn's team absorbs the support load. The confidential element of our expansion thinking is noted directly below.

board note of fafog-yahap: Project Rusdor slips by a full year because of the audit delay.